Quality ControlIn order to maintain consistent quality in sterile cell culture media products, strict quality control of each production lot is essential. Written procedures in accordance with current Good Manufacturing Practices (cGMPs) provide quality control from start to finish for each product produced. Final product testing includes the following:USP Sterility – Tests are performed on representative samples using the membrane filtration procedure in accordance with the US Pharmacopoeia or EP Pharmacopoeia. Culture media used are fluid thioglycollate medium (FTM) and trypticase soy broth (TSB). The test samples are filtered and the filters are immersed in FTM and TSB. TSB cultures are incubated at 22.5°C ± 2.5°C. FTM cultures are incubated at 32.5°C ± 2.5°C. The cultures are incubated for 14 days, during which they are periodically examined and sterility results are recorded.Chemistries (pH and osmolality) – Tests are performed on representative samples from each lot using routinely calibrated equipment. Osmolality is determined by means of the highly repeatable freezing point method.Endotoxin – Products are tested for endotoxin content using the Kinetic-QCL™ Assay. Test dilutions used are screened for inhibition and enhancement in the Kinetic-QCL™ Assay. Endotoxin levels for these products are available on Certificates of Analysis.The combined result of all in-process monitoring and final product testing is the further assurance that each lot has been prepared not only according to approved written procedures, but has passed test criteria, and will meet design specifications.

Liquid Cell Culture MediaChemically defined liquid media are used to provide nutrients for cell culture growth in research, diagnostic, and manufacturing applications. In order to meet your specific needs, our production and quality control procedures for liquid media emphasize control. Our goal is to provide you with high quality products that are consistent from batch to batch. With all of the time that you take to optimize your systems, we want to provide you with products you can trust.All BioWhittaker™ Classical Media products are labelled for research use only and are manufactured in accordance with ISO:9001. A Device Master Record (DMR) is prepared for every liquid medium product. It defines the procedures for production from receipt of raw materials to final product release, the environmental and processing controls required, as well as product specifications, including packaging and labeling. Product manufacturing is consistent with the requirements defined in the DMR, which ensures that each lot of a product is consistent with all other lots of the same product.Chemicals used to prepare liquid media products are purchased according to the raw material qualifications from approved suppliers. Each lot must meet established component specifications before it is released by Quality Assurance for use. We manufacture all liquid cell culture media using Water for Injection (WFI) quality water, which has been prepared by ultrafiltration, reverse osmosis, deionization, and distillation. Liquid media is sterile filtered through pharmaceutical-grade sterilizing filters. The for -mulations used for standard classical media products are those recommended by the Tissue Culture Association.

Serum-free media and reagents have a wide range of applications, including production of monoclonal antibodies, viral antigens, and recombinant proteins using a variety of mammalian and invertebrate cell lines. There are numerous advantages associated with the use of serum-free media formulations.

■ Benefits – Increased definition – Increased lot-to-lot consistency – Simplified purification and downstream processing – Better control over the physiological condition of

cultures – Ability to optimize formulations for specific cell types

Introduction

Serum-free media propriety formulations must satisfy a number of nutritional and physical requirements of cells that are normally addressed by the presence of serum. Serum proteins, such as albumin, fibronectin, and fetuin serve a variety of functions that include adsorbing toxic compounds, providing protection against shear forces in bioreactors, creating a matrix for cellular attachment to surfaces, and acting as a carrier for lipids and other growth factors.

UltraCULTURE™ Serum-free Medium - Chemically Defined is a complete, all-purpose medium designed for the cultivation of a wide variety of adherent and non-adherent mammalian cell types. UltraCULTURE™ Medium can be used to support fusion of cells during hybridoma formation, growth of monocyte, macrophage, epithelial, and fibroblastic cell lines, and generation of virus particles for vaccine production. The medium is supplemented with recombinant human insulin, bovine transferrin, and a purified mixture of bovine serum proteins, including albumin. The total protein concentration of UltraCULTURE™ Medium is approximately 3 mg/mL.UltraCULTURE™ Medium can be supplemented with Cryoprotective Medium (Cat. No. 12-132A) to cryopreserve cells in a serum-free environment. UltraCULTURE™ Medium does not contain L-glutamine; please add 5 mL of 200 mM L-glutamine solution (Cat. No. 17-605 or 17-905) prior touse.The formulation for UltraCULTURE™ Medium has beensubmitted to the FDA as a Master File. Permission to cross-reference the Master File may be obtained by contacting the Regulatory Affairs Department.Turbidity may develop in UltraCULTURE™ Medium;experiments have determined that the turbidity will notalter the performance of the product

X-VIVO™ Serum-free Hematopoietic Cell Media – Chemically Defined media provides a nutritionally complete and balanced environment for a variety of cells including lymphokine activated killer (LAK) cells, peripheral blood lymphocytes (PBL), and tumor infiltrating lymphocytes (TIL). These media do not contain any exogenous growth factors, artificial stimulators of cellular proliferation, or undefined supplements. They are devoid of any protein kinase C stimulators and are suitable for the investigation of second messenger systems in the activation of human and murine lymphocytes. The formulations are complete and contain pharmaceutical grade human albumin, recombinant human insulin, and pasteurized human transferrin. All X-VIVO™ Media products are listed with the FDA in a Drug Master File. Permission to cross-reference the Master File may be obtained by contacting the Regulatory Affairs Department.

X-VIVO™ 10 Serum-free Hematopoietic Cell Media – Chemically DefinedThe X-VIVO™ 10 Media formulations are designed to support the generation of LAK cells in a serum-free environment. The original protocols involved the incubation of patient or normal donor peripheral blood lymphocytes (PBL) at 1.0–3.0 × 106 cells/mL for a period of 3 days in the presence of 1,000 Cetus units of rIL-2/mL. Optimal LAK cell generation is achieved when peri pheral blood lymphocytes are incubated for 3–10 days at a density of 1.0–6.0 × 106 cells/mL in the presence of 100–1,000 Cetus units of rIL-2. X-VIVO™ 10 Media is available as a 1X liquid in two convenient formulations.

X-VIVO™ Serum-free Hematopoietic Cell Medium – Chemically DefinedSerum-free Media for Hematopoietic Cells

X-VIVO™ 15 Serum-free Hematopoietic Cell Media – Chemically DefinedX-VIVO™ 15 Media are similar in composition to X-VIVO™ 10 Media and have been optimized for the proliferation of tumor infiltrating lymphocytes (TIL) under serum-free conditions. X-VIVO™ 15 Media supports the proliferation of purified CD3+ cells isolated from peripheral blood and human tumors. X-VIVO™ 15 Media can also be used to support the growth of human monocytes, macrophage cells and cell lines, PBL, granulocytes, and natural killer (NK) cells. In addition, X-VIVO™ 15 Media provide a serum-free environment for the expansion of HUT-78 and related human lymphocytic cell lines.

X-VIVO™ 20 Serum-free Hematopoietic Cell Media – Chemically DefinedX-VIVO™ 20 Medium is optimized to support the generation of lymphokine activated killer (LAK) cells from monocyte-depleted peripheral blood lymphocytes (PBL) at high density. Initial cell densities between 2.0–3.0 × 107 cells/ml can be used to successfully generate LAK cells. X-VIVO™ 20 Medium may also be used as a growth medium for PBL and tumor infiltrating lymphocytes (TIL).

Complement fixation (CF) is an immunological test that can be used to detect the presence of either a specific antibody or a specific antigen. Complement fixation reagents include Guinea Pig Complement, Sheep Erythrocytes, and Hemolysin. The CF test involves two basic principles:

– Complement is irreversibly bound (fixed) to antigen-antibody complexes. The degree of fixation is governed by the relative concentration of either antigen or antibody.

– The lysis of sheep red blood cells in the presence of homologous antibody (hemolysin) is dependent upon the presence of complement.

The complement fixation test is interpreted as follows: antigen + serum + complement + sensitized sheep red blood cells

– antibody present = no hemolysis – antibody absent = hemolysis

Influenza virus was shown to agglutinate chicken red blood cells (RBC). Subsequently, a variety of viruses have also been shown to agglutinate RBC’s from several different species. Viruses have been shown to agglutinate sheep red blood cells, chicken red blood cells, and guinea pig red blood cells in the hemagglutination (HA) assay. It has also been observed that specific antibodies can inhibit

Viral Serology

hemagglutination which led to the development of the hemagglutination inhibition (HAI) assay. The HA-HAI capability provides a fast and easy method of quantifying both viral antigen and antibody. The specificity and sensitivity of the HAI assay is dependent upon the characteristics of the HA antigen and its interaction with antibody, which will vary with the particular virus under test.

The complement fixation test uses sheep red blood cells (sRBC), pre-bound by anti-sRBC antibody, hemolysin, and serum (usually from a guinea pig) as a source of complement. Complement is a system of serum proteins which interact with the antigen-antibody complex. This reaction causes pores to form in the membrane of the cell which ultimately results in lysis of the red blood cell.
